The health and safety risks of overheating

Working in extreme heat can quickly escalate from uncomfortable to dangerous. Risks include dehydration, fatigue, slower reaction times, and even heat stroke. Overheating affects concentration, increases the likelihood of accidents, and poses a risk to long-term health.

Heat stress happens when the body can’t cool itself fast enough, leading to symptoms like dizziness, nausea, and in severe cases, collapse or organ failure. In this context, clothing acts as a critical tool for thermoregulation.

Wearing breathable, regulation-compliant clothing that helps manage body temperature is one of the most effective ways to reduce these risks.

Safety workwear for warm weather – key features to look for

To truly protect workers in the heat, workwear needs to do more than just fit well; it needs to perform. The right gear should be lightweight, breathable, UV-protective, and able to wick moisture efficiently.

Focusing on these core features makes it easier to keep your team cool, safe, and focused on the job, even on the hottest days.

 

Lightweight, breathable fabrics

Fabrics make or break summer workwear. Breathable, moisture-wicking materials like cotton blends or technical fabrics promote airflow and draw sweat away from the skin. This prevents the discomfort and danger of soaked clothing.

Avoid thick synthetics that trap heat. Instead, choose materials designed for fast drying and heat release for comfort that lasts through long, hot shifts.

 

UV protection and ventilation

UV exposure is a serious risk for outdoor workers. Clothing with a built-in UPF (Ultraviolet Protection Factor) shields skin from harmful rays and reduces the risk of sunburn and long-term skin damage.

Ventilation matters just as much. Look for shirts, trousers, and hi-vis gear with vented panels or mesh zones. These allow body heat to escape and airflow to circulate, helping workers stay cooler, longer.

Headwear and eye protection

Start at the top! Wide-brimmed hard hats and caps with neck flaps offer excellent sun protection for the face and neck. Mesh-panel headwear adds ventilation, keeping the head cooler in direct sunlight.

Safety sunglasses with UV-rated lenses and anti-fog coatings protect the eyes while reducing glare, making it easier to focus and avoid accidents.

 

Upper body clothing

Short sleeves may offer breathability, but ventilated long-sleeve shirts provide more complete sun protection. The best options combine airflow with moisture-wicking performance to reduce heat retention and skin irritation. They also help shield arms from abrasions, sparks, or contact with hot surfaces, offering an extra layer of protection without sacrificing comfort.

Look for high-visibility gear with mesh panels, which are ideal for both safety and summer comfort.

 

Lower body and footwear considerations

Trousers with mesh linings, vented seams, or zip-open air panels offer critical relief for the legs. They also help reduce sweat buildup in heavy-duty work environments.

Breathable steel-toe boots provide foot protection without turning into heat traps. Pair them with moisture-wicking socks to avoid blisters, odour, and fungal infections. Advanced work trousers with cooling technology can also boost comfort throughout long shifts in the sun.
